The experience of individuals navigating their existence following the dissolution of a long-term marriage later in life, often after the age of 50, presents unique challenges and opportunities. This period involves significant adjustments in areas such as finances, living arrangements, social connections, and emotional well-being. For example, someone who has spent decades building a life with a partner now faces the prospect of redefining their identity and purpose independently.

Understanding the complexities of this life stage is increasingly important due to demographic trends indicating a rise in later-life separations. Historically, divorce rates were highest among younger couples; however, there is a growing prevalence of separations among older adults. Recognizing the potential for personal growth, renewed relationships, and redefined happiness within this demographic can foster a more supportive and understanding societal perspective. Moreover, addressing financial planning, healthcare considerations, and social integration becomes crucial for promoting well-being.

These terms represent distinct legal and social statuses relating to intimate partnerships. “Single” denotes an individual who is not currently in a legally recognized marriage or civil union. “Married” signifies the state of being joined in a legally recognized union. “Separated” describes a situation where a married couple is living apart, often as a precursor to divorce. “Life after divorce” encompasses the experiences, adjustments, and legal processes that occur following the dissolution of a marriage.

Understanding these classifications is crucial for legal, financial, and social planning. Each status carries specific rights and responsibilities regarding property, finances, healthcare, and dependent care. Historically, societal attitudes toward these states have evolved significantly, impacting legal frameworks and individual experiences. The transition between these statuses often involves complex emotional, logistical, and legal considerations.

Financial planning, often significantly adjusted during dissolution of marriage, can involve existing protection policies. These policies, designed to provide financial security upon the policyholder’s death, become subject to division or modification depending on jurisdiction and specific circumstances. For instance, a policy owned by one spouse, naming the other as beneficiary, may require reassessment to reflect altered familial relationships.

Maintaining appropriate coverage during and after legal separation offers continued safeguards. It ensures financial stability for dependents, addresses alimony or child support obligations if unforeseen events occur, and provides resources to manage final expenses. Historically, settlements often overlooked these assets; however, modern legal practices increasingly recognize their role in long-term financial security and equitable asset distribution.
